#40300e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#40300e is composed of 25.1% red, 18.8% green and 5.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 25% magenta, 78.1% yellow and 74.9% black. It has a hue angle of 40.8 degrees, a saturation of 64.1% and a lightness of 15.3%. #40300e color hex could be obtained by blending #80601c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333300.

#40300e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#40300e has RGB values of R:64, G:48, B:14 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.25, Y:0.78, K:0.75. Its decimal value is 4206606.
